From 484c8bf96d406596112b12e2bed6d9434eb5b60a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?J=C3=B6rg=20Frings-F=C3=BCrst?= Date: Mon, 14 Sep 2020 14:08:56 +0200 Subject: Reinstall init.d scripts --- debian/changelog | 3 +++ debian/control | 4 +++- debian/lintian-overrides | 2 ++ debian/maintscript | 4 ---- debian/rules | 6 ++++++ 5 files changed, 14 insertions(+), 5 deletions(-) create mode 100644 debian/lintian-overrides delete mode 100644 debian/maintscript diff --git a/debian/changelog b/debian/changelog index 4d740fe..34b0b7d 100644 --- a/debian/changelog +++ b/debian/changelog @@ -1,6 +1,9 @@ ipmiutil (3.1.7-1) UNRELEASED; urgency=medium * New upstrewam release. + * Reinstall init.d scripts. + * Migrate to debhelper 13: + - Bump minimum debhelper-compat version in debian/control to = 13. -- Jörg Frings-Fürst Mon, 14 Sep 2020 12:28:25 +0200 diff --git a/debian/control b/debian/control index bcb9e65..2a08094 100644 --- a/debian/control +++ b/debian/control @@ -3,7 +3,7 @@ Section: utils Priority: optional Maintainer: Jörg Frings-Fürst Build-Depends: - debhelper-compat (= 12), + debhelper-compat (= 13), libfreeipmi-dev (>= 1.1.5) | libopenipmi-dev (>=2.0.18), libssl-dev, libtool-bin, @@ -20,9 +20,11 @@ Depends: ${shlibs:Depends}, ${misc:Depends}, anacron, + init-system-helpers, lsb-base (>= 3.0-6), rpcbind Pre-Depends: + ${misc:Pre-Depends}, dpkg (>= 1.15.7.2) Description: IPMI management utilities ipmiutil performs a series of common IPMI server management diff --git a/debian/lintian-overrides b/debian/lintian-overrides new file mode 100644 index 0000000..b352cfd --- /dev/null +++ b/debian/lintian-overrides @@ -0,0 +1,2 @@ +# see bug #932378 +missing-versioned-depends-on-init-system-helpers diff --git a/debian/maintscript b/debian/maintscript deleted file mode 100644 index 0d95117..0000000 --- a/debian/maintscript +++ /dev/null @@ -1,4 +0,0 @@ -rm_conffile /etc/init.d/ipmi_port 3.0.0-3~ -rm_conffile /etc/init.d/ipmiutil_asy 3.0.0-3~ -rm_conffile /etc/init.d/ipmiutil_evt 3.0.0-3~ -rm_conffile /etc/init.d/ipmiutil_wdt 3.0.0-3~ diff --git a/debian/rules b/debian/rules index 183b5fb..e56a783 100755 --- a/debian/rules +++ b/debian/rules @@ -37,3 +37,9 @@ override_dh_installsystemd: dh_installsystemd --name ipmi_port --no-enable --no-start dh_installsystemd --name ipmiutil_asy --no-enable --no-start dh_installsystemd --name ipmiutil_evt --no-enable --no-start + +override_dh_installinit: + dh_installinit --name ipmiutil_wdt + dh_installinit --name ipmi_port --no-enable --no-start + dh_installinit --name ipmiutil_asy --no-enable --no-start + dh_installinit --name ipmiutil_evt --no-enable --no-start -- cgit v1.2.3